Hi everyone, thanks for helping me. Recently my pc has been shutting down out of nowhere and the GPU fan going insanely fast when it does.
I've changed the GPU paste a month ago since it was doing the same thing and it stopped for a while but the problem came back,

But recently ive noticed it does that when the table get hit and receives a vibration shock, like slamming my fist on the table or the chair hitting it, what could be happening? I have a GTX 1060 with a 520w seasonic PSU
 
Solution
If movement causes your PC to crash or reboot, then you either have an intermittent short or open connection somewhere. I'd start with taking the PC apart and examining every component for bad solder joints and physical damage.
